Purse Corporation acquired 70 percent of Scarf Corporation’s ownership on January 1, 20X8, for $140,000. At that date, Scarf reported capital stock outstanding of $120,000 and retained earnings of $80,000, and the fair value of the noncontrolling interest was equal to 30 percent of the book value of Scarf. During 20X8, Scarf reported net income of $30,000 and comprehensive income of $36,000 and paid dividends of $25,000. Required: Present all consolidation entries needed at December 31, 20X8, to prepare a complete set of consolidated financial statements for Purse Corporation and its subsidiary.

Penny Manufacturing Company acquired 75 percent of Saul Corporation stock at underlying book value. At the date of acquisition, the fair value of the noncontrolling interest was equal to 25 percent of Saul’s book value. The balance sheets of the two companies for January 1, 20X1, are as follows: On January 2, 20X1, Penny purchased an additional 2,500 shares of common stock directly from Saul for $150,000. Required:a. Prepare the consolidation entry needed to complete a consolidated balance sheet worksheet immediately following the issuance of additional shares to Penny.  b. Prepare a consolidated balance sheet worksheet immediately following the issuance of additional shares to Penny.
